contents We present lattice results for the flavor diagonal charges of the proton from the analysis of eight ensembles generated using 2+1+1-flavors of highly improved staggered quarks (HISQ) by the MILC collaboration. The calculation includes all the needed connected and disconnected contributions to nucleon three-point function. For extracting matrix elements using fits to the spectral decomposition of these correlation functions, two strategies to remove excited state contributions are employed and compared. To renormalize these charges, the 2+1-flavor mixing matrix is calculated in the RI-sMOM intermediate scheme on the lattice. The final results are presented in the $\overline{\text{MS}}$ scheme at scale 2GeV. The axial charges for the proton are $g_A^u = 0.781(25)$, $g_A^d = -0.440(39)$, and $g_A^s = -0.055(9)$; the tensor charges are $g_T^u = 0.782(28)$, $g_T^d = -0.195(16)$, and $g_T^s = -0.0016(12)$; and the scalar charges are $g_S^u = 9.39(88)$, $g_S^d = 8.84(93)$, and $g_S^s = 0.37(14)$. Results for the neutron are given by the $u \leftrightarrow d$ interchange. Results for the sigma terms are $σ_{πN}|_{\rm standard} = 42(6)~{\rm MeV}$ from a "standard" analysis and $σ_{πN}|_{N π} = 61(6)~{\rm MeV}$ from a "$Nπ$" analysis that includes the contributions of multihadron $Nπ$ excited states as motivated by chiral perturbation theory. Our preferred value $σ_{πN}|_{N π}$ is consistent with the phenomenological extraction from $π- N$ scattering data. The strangeness content of the proton, for which the "standard" analysis is appropriate, is $σ_{s}|_{\rm standard} = 35(13)~{\rm MeV}$.
